Abstract
Gout is one of the most common etiologies of inflammatory monoarticular arthritis. Recent literature is reviewed to compare a novel advancement in chronic gout medication, febuxostat, to its counterpart allopurinol, through the identification of significant findings and improvements. Literature review concluded that febuxostat serves as a viable alternative when compared to allopurinol.
